Most Rich Families Will Lose It All. About seven in 10 wealthy families lose their fortune by the second generation, according to a study of more than 3,200 high-net worth families by the Williams Group wealth consultancy.

Endowment Dollars Traced To Tobacco, Oil And Private Prison Companies. In 2015, Ohio University banned the use of tobacco products on its Athens campus. Despite that, money invested in one of the world's largest tobacco companies can be traced to the university's endowment fund.

Sequoia Capital Concludes Secondary Stake Sale At $180M. Sequoia Capital has reportedly concluded a $180 million secondary stake sale of eight of its portfolio companies to Madison Capital, as per a TOI report. This comes at time when the venture fund is looking to consolidate its holdings, as per sources close to the development.

Crispin Odey, Down 33.7% Year Over Year, Feels Lonely. The turbulence in Crispin Odey's performance continued in March, with the OEI Mac hedge fund run by England's wealthiest individual losing -3.9% on the month, bringing the year-over-year performance to -33.7%.
